dd-wrt was close to dead last time I checked (not having released new
builds in more then a year), if you already go with an alternative
firmware openwrt though a bit more hassle is the better bet since it
is actively updated.
(Also the OP requested openwrt support)

>> I am looking for a good quality DSL modem or WAP with DSL modem that
>> supports OpenWRT in Israel. Any suggestions? Price is not an issue.
>>
>> The problem that I am trying to solve is PPTP client connections from
>> behind the modem being blocked because the cheaper DSL modem that I am using
>> (D-Link DSL-2500U Russian version) does not seem to be able to forward GRE
>> (only TCP, USD or both) in "virtual server" mode and cannot NAT GRE in "DMZ"
>> mode.
